Today’s MotD: The Feather Principle. We start a new week focusing on “Faith”. For day 1, Melody shares her feather principle whereby whenever she sees one on the ground or floating through the air, it reminds her that she is where she needs to be right now and that everything is going as planned.
I usually feel that way when I see what’s called “angel” numbers: 111, 444, 1234, and so on. When I happen to look at my phone and see one, it reminds me that I’m not alone and that I’m fully supported. Or I take it as confirmation about something I just thought or said.
Both of these concepts remind me of having faith in some form of power greater than myself and that I’m not alone. It gives me peace and helps allay my fears and insecurities. It also gives me the confidence to move forward.
For most of my youth my faith was associated with the Catholic Church and its tenets. As I grew older I came to realize that they no longer served me, if anything they hindered me from living my full potential.
All that being said, I believe we’re being encouraged, most of all, to have faith in ourselves and what we’re capable of achieving—if we allow ourselves to do so. Having faith in a Higher Power that helps us along the way ? That’s just the cherry on top.

ABOUT THE 2025 Mandalas of the Day
Throughout the year, I’ll be building one large (48”x48”) Tibetan-styled Mandala one piece at a time…one puzzle piece at a time, that is. The mandala design and the reversed puzzle side were printed on artist-quality watercolor paper. The forward facing puzzle side was printed on a 48”x48” wood panel.
Each day, at random, I’ll be painting in watercolors one of the 365 watercolor puzzle pieces, that by the end of the year will become Archangel Mandala #4. Read more about the Archangel Series. The word/message for each piece will be inspired by Melody Beattie’s book “52 Weeks of Conscious Contact”.
Ultimately, the message of this mandala is about how we are all uniquely part of the one.
